The O.H.B 7-in-1 is a budget-friendly air multi-styler positioned as an Airwrap alternative. It combines air-wrap technology with auto-rotating 1.25" curling barrels, an oval volumizing brush, paddle smoothing brush, concentrator nozzle, and diffuser. Powered by 110,000 RPM airflow, it includes 4 heat settings and 2 speed levels with ionic frizz control. At 0.6 lbs, it's exceptionally lightweight with a 360° rotatable head, making it travel-friendly.
Styling approach: Hot-air brush with auto-rotating barrels (Coanda-inspired, not true Coanda airflow). Works best for volume, curls, and basic smoothing on fine to medium hair. Thicker or very long hair may require patience.
Learning curve: Moderate—the auto-rotating barrels simplify curling versus manual wrap, but technique still matters. Noise level: Expected to be moderate to loud (110k RPM is high-speed). Heat damage: Ionic tech and temperature control help, but this is still hot-air styling, not low-heat Coanda.
Who it's for: Budget shoppers seeking a multi-attachment air styler, travelers, and those wanting to experiment before investing in Dyson or Shark. Not ideal for very thick, long, or curly hair seeking salon-grade results.

Pros & cons
Pros
- Excellent price point (~$110 on sale)
- Seven attachments cover multiple styles
- Auto-rotating barrels ease the learning curve
- Lightweight and travel-friendly
- Includes travel case
- Ionic technology for frizz control
- Multiple heat and speed settings
Cons
- O.H.B is a lesser-known generic brand with minimal track record
- Mixed durability reports—attachment fit concerns common in budget multi-stylers
- Slower drying than professional-grade tools (110k RPM sounds high but delivers less airflow than Dyson/Shark)
- Not ideal for thick, long, or curly hair
- Steep learning curve for salon-quality curls
- Loud operation expected at this power level
- Limited community presence and professional endorsements
